5-Day Family-Friendly Itinerary in Goa (September 2023)

  1. Day 1: Explore Calangute Beach
    40 minutes (21.5 km) from Dabolim Airport

    Start your trip by heading to Calangute Beach, a popular destination in Goa. Spend the morning building sandcastles and enjoying the beachside activities. In the afternoon, visit the nearby Tibetan Market for some souvenir shopping. In the evening, take a leisurely stroll along the Calangute Beach Road and indulge in delicious Goan street food.

    • Water Sports: ₹500-₹2000, 1-2 hours
    • Tibetan Market Shopping: ₹200-₹1000, 1-2 hours
    • Street Food: ₹100-₹500, 1-2 hours
  2. Day 2: Visit Dudhsagar Falls
    2 hours 30 minutes (76.4 km) from Calangute Beach

    Embark on an exciting day trip to Dudhsagar Falls, one of the tallest waterfalls in India. Start early in the morning to reach the falls before the crowds. Spend the morning marveling at the picturesque beauty of the cascading water. In the afternoon, enjoy a picnic lunch amidst nature. Return to your hotel in the evening.

    • Dudhsagar Falls Entrance Fee: ₹400, 4-6 hours
    • Picnic Lunch: ₹300-₹500, 1-2 hours
  3. Day 3: Discover the Spice Plantations
    1 hour 30 minutes (48.5 km) from Dudhsagar Falls

    Embark on a guided tour of the spice plantations in Goa. Learn about various spices, their cultivation, and their culinary uses. Enjoy a traditional Goan lunch amidst the lush greenery. In the afternoon, take a relaxing walk through the spice gardens and get a glimpse of the local flora and fauna.

    • Spice Plantation Tour: ₹700-₹1500, 2-3 hours
    • Goan Lunch: ₹300-₹500, 1-2 hours
  4. Day 4: Explore Old Goa
    40 minutes (23.8 km) from Spice Plantations

    Visit the historic town of Old Goa, known for its magnificent churches and colonial architecture. Start your day by exploring the Basilica of Bom Jesus and the Se Cathedral. In the afternoon, visit the Museum of Christian Art and delve into Goa's rich cultural heritage. In the evening, take a sunset cruise along the Mandovi River.

    • Basilica of Bom Jesus: Free entry, 1-2 hours
    • Museum of Christian Art: ₹100-₹200, 1-2 hours
    • Sunset Cruise: ₹1000-₹1500, 2-3 hours
  5. Day 5: Enjoy a Day at Anjuna Flea Market
    40 minutes (19.5 km) from Old Goa

    Wrap up your trip with a visit to the vibrant Anjuna Flea Market. Spend the morning exploring the market stalls filled with handicrafts, clothing, and jewelry. In the afternoon, relax on Anjuna Beach and soak up the sun. End your day with a mesmerizing sunset at Chapora Fort.

    • Anjuna Flea Market Shopping: ₹200-₹1000, 2-3 hours
    • Beach Relaxation: Free, flexible
    • Chapora Fort Visit: Free, 1-2 hours

Recommendations

If you have more time, consider visiting the lively beaches of Baga and Vagator, or taking a day trip to the stunning Aguada Fort. For a fun and educational experience, visit the Goa Science Centre and Planetarium. To make the most of your money, negotiate prices at local markets and opt for authentic Goan cuisine at local eateries. Don't forget to indulge in some water sports, such as jet skiing or parasailing, for an adrenaline-filled adventure!
